The majority of the students in the University of Arizona's College of Architecture, Planning and Landscape Architecture are graduate students or at the professional level. One class offering is a Research Methods class, and the instructor of that class sets aside two full class periods for library instruction by the Architecture Librarian (me). Other faculty members use the librarian for BI sessions more or less as they feel it's necessary. The instructors of the studio classes, for example, feel less need than those who's classes require the production of a research paper or project. Part of my job, of course, is to convince them ALL that their students need instruction. The number of classes I teach each semester depends heavily on who is teaching and what classes are being offered.
